Abstract

The invention discloses a dual-concave-mirror grinding and polishing upper jig, and belongs to the technical field of dual-concave-mirror grinding and polishing. The dual-concave-mirror grinding and polishing upper jig comprises a clamping head and a connecting body. A circular groove is formed in the top end of the clamping head. The bottom face of the circular groove is provided with an arc-shaped boss. The connecting body is provided with a plurality of jetting airways for making the connecting body communicate with the clamping head. Dual concave mirrors are blown down to a lower end grinding head through the air sprayed of the jetting airways to be directly grabbed by a mechanical hand, the full-automatic production can be realized, and production efficiency is greatly improved. The side wall of the clamping head is evenly provided with a plurality of inclined grooves. A discharge hole is formed in each inclined groove and used for discharging polishing powder on edges, so the aperture local tolerance distortion of the edges of the dual concave mirrors is effectively avoided. Two sealing grooves are formed in the side wall of the connecting block, and a positioning conical groove is formed in the center of the tail end of the connecting block. O-rings are placed in the sealing grooves, and rapid positioning and connecting can be conducted on the O-rings and an external upper shaft

technical field [0001] The invention relates to the technical field of grinding and polishing of double concave mirrors, in particular to an upper jig for grinding and polishing of double concave mirrors. Background technique [0002] In recent years, with the technological progress in the field of opto-mechanical-electrical, various scanners, projectors, digital cameras and other new products have an increasing demand for optical lenses and higher precision requirements. Therefore, continuous improvement of productivity and development of automation is the development theme that the optical cold processing industry must seek. By aligning the center of the ball and adding a professional robot or manipulator to the grinding and polishing machine, the problem of workpiece transfer in each processing cavity can be effectively solved, manpower is liberated, production costs are reduced, and production efficiency is improved.
